Boosting Brain Performance: Neurofeedback Techniques for Improved Well-being

Neurofeedback offers a groundbreaking approach to enhance brain health by providing real-time monitoring of your brainwave activity. Through this dynamic process, you can learn to influence your brainwaves, cultivating cognitive performance. By modifying specific brainwave patterns, neurofeedback can alleviate symptoms of depression, enhance focus and attention, and even facilitate memory.

Neurofeedback employs sophisticated sensors to detect your brainwaves. This data is then processed by a computer and presented to you in a user-friendly manner, often through visual signals. As you interact with the neurofeedback system, you begin to perceive the connection between your thoughts, emotions, and brainwave activity. By making your mental states, you can shape your brainwaves, ultimately leading to positive changes in your cognitive and emotional well-being.

Sharpening Your Mind: Neurofeedback and ADHD Concentration

Living with ADHD can often feel like a constant battle against distractions. The brain struggles to stay on target, making it difficult to concentrate on tasks and achieve goals. However, there is a promising tool that can help you reclaim control: neurofeedback. This non-invasive method uses real-time feedback from your brain waves to train your concentration. Through targeted exercises, you can learn to influence your brain activity, ultimately leading to improved concentration and a more sense of focus.

  • It's a form of neurofeedback that help you interpret your brain waves and learn to shift them to achieve a state of deeper concentration.
  • By exercising with neurofeedback, you build the neural pathways that support focus, making it easier to stay on task in your daily life.

Additionally, neurofeedback can also have positive effects on other symptoms associated with ADHD, such as restlessness. By addressing these underlying issues, neurofeedback can create a holistic approach for managing ADHD and attaining your full potential.
